On board the Type 12 frigate HMS Londonderry (1958) alongside the west wall in the basin at Rosyth Dockyard, near the end of her modernization which commenced 7 July 1967 and completed 28 January 1970. The photographer is in the transmitting station cooling compartment between 28¼ and 30½ stations on the centreline of 2 deck looking forward showing two 692/2 cabinets on the left and a 692/2 test unit with an EAH unit above it on the right. Four junction boxes are against the forward bulkhead.
